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
Add kubectl debug alpha command #88004
This first version of
What type of PR is this?
What this PR does / why we need it: This is the first of a series of PRs to implement kubernetes/enhancements#1441
Which issue(s) this PR fixes:
Special notes for your reviewer:
Does this PR introduce a user-facing change?:
Additional documentation e.g., KEPs (Kubernetes Enhancement Proposals), usage docs, etc.:
1 similar comment
Close enough. I'm pretty certain the timeouts on the e2e gce test are unrelated.
Note for reviewers: My goal is to get an alpha command merged so that we can begin iterating. I'm new to changing kubectl and feel like I have a shaky grasp on convention. Please point out where I've deviated from convention and request refactors if appropriate. Thanks!
This first version of `kubectl alpha debug` is an import of the existing kubectl-debug plugin, which supports adding ephemeral containers to running pods. This attempts to follow patterns used by other kubectl commands such as run, exec and scale.
[APPROVALNOTIFIER] This PR is APPROVED
The full list of commands accepted by this bot can be found here.
The pull request process is described here